Kalyan Nagar Population - Alwar, Rajasthan

Kalyan Nagar is a medium size village located in Bansur Tehsil of Alwar district, Rajasthan with total 192 families residing. The Kalyan Nagar village has population of 1118 of which 593 are males while 525 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Kalyan Nagar village population of children with age 0-6 is 155 which makes up 13.86 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kalyan Nagar village is 885 which is lower than Rajasthan state average of 928. Child Sex Ratio for the Kalyan Nagar as per census is 824, lower than Rajasthan average of 888.

Kalyan Nagar village has higher literacy rate compared to Rajasthan. In 2011, literacy rate of Kalyan Nagar village was 76.43 % compared to 66.11 % of Rajasthan. In Kalyan Nagar Male literacy stands at 88.78 % while female literacy rate was 62.64 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 19.95 % of total population in Kalyan Nagar village. The village Kalyan Nagar currently doesn’t have any Schedule Tribe (ST) population.

Work Profile

In Kalyan Nagar village out of total population, 621 were engaged in work activities. 38.65 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 61.35 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 621 workers engaged in Main Work, 155 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 6 were Agricultural labourer.
